You won't need a monster PC to run Resident Evil Requiem
PositiveArtificial Intelligence
Great news for gamers! The upcoming Resident Evil Requiem, set to launch on February 27, 2026, has confirmed its PC requirements, revealing that you won't need a high-end monster PC to enjoy the game. With minimum specs asking for just an Intel Core i5-8500 or Ryzen, this makes the game accessible to a wider audience. This is significant as it allows more players to experience the latest installment in the beloved franchise without the need for expensive hardware.

Partially-Supervised Neural Network Model For Quadratic Multiparametric Programming
NeutralArtificial Intelligence
A new study introduces a partially-supervised neural network model aimed at improving the efficiency of solving multiparametric quadratic programming (mp-QP) problems, which are crucial in various engineering fields. This model utilizes the piecewise affine characteristics of deep neural networks to enhance predictions, addressing limitations of traditional methods. The advancement is significant as it could lead to more optimal and feasible solutions in engineering applications, potentially transforming how complex optimization problems are approached.

Agent Skills Enable a New Class of Realistic and Trivially Simple Prompt Injections
NeutralArtificial Intelligence
A recent announcement from a leading LLM company introduced Agent Skills, a framework designed to enhance continual learning by allowing agents to acquire new knowledge from simple markdown files. While this innovation could significantly improve the functionality of language models, it also raises concerns about security, as it opens the door to trivial prompt injections. This development is crucial as it highlights both the potential and the risks associated with advancements in AI technology.
LLMBisect: Breaking Barriers in Bug Bisection with A Comparative Analysis Pipeline
PositiveArtificial Intelligence
LLMBisect is making waves in the field of software security by introducing a new comparative analysis pipeline for bug bisection. This innovative approach addresses the limitations of traditional methods, which often assume that the bug-inducing commit and the patch commit affect the same functions. By overcoming these barriers, LLMBisect enhances the accuracy of identifying the source of bugs, ultimately leading to more efficient software development and improved security. This advancement is crucial as it not only streamlines the debugging process but also helps developers maintain the integrity of their software.
Learning Pseudorandom Numbers with Transformers: Permuted Congruential Generators, Curricula, and Interpretability
PositiveArtificial Intelligence
A recent study explores how Transformer models can effectively learn sequences generated by Permuted Congruential Generators (PCGs), which are more complex than traditional linear congruential generators. This research is significant as it demonstrates the capability of advanced AI models to tackle challenging tasks in random number generation, potentially enhancing their application in various fields such as cryptography and simulations.
